Warning Signs You Need Desiccant Dehumidification
Ignoring the signs of desiccant dehumidification can lead to serious problems, including mold growth, structural damage, and even health hazards. Here are some common warning signs that you need desiccant dehumidification services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your home that just won’t go away, it’s a sign that you have a moisture problem. This can be caused by a variety of factors, including high humidity, water damage, or poor ventilation.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on the ceiling are a clear sign that you have a moisture problem. This can be caused by a variety of factors, including roof leaks, pipe bursts, or condensation.
Damp Walls and Floors
If you notice that your walls and floors feel damp to the touch, it’s a sign that you have a moisture problem. This can be caused by a variety of factors, including high humidity, water damage, or poor ventilation.
Peeling Paint and Warped Wood
Peeling paint and warped wood are clear signs that you have a moisture problem. This can be caused by a variety of factors, including high humidity, water damage, or poor ventilation.
Mold and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ew growth are serious health hazards that can be caused by a variety of factors, including high humidity, water damage, or poor ventilation. If you notice mold or mildew growth in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Desiccant Dehumidification Cost in Parker, TX
The cost of desiccant dehumidification services in Parker,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common desiccant dehumidification services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Equipment Setup and Operation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The type and number of equipment needed, as well as the duration of the process. |
| Drying and Monitoring | $1,500 – $6,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the duration of the process.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of cleaning required. |
